产品详情

Product Details

Verified Reactivity
Human
Reported Reactivity
Guinea Pig
Antibody Type
Monoclonal
Host Species
Mouse
Immunogen
Ba/F3 cell line expressing human TLR4
Formulation
Phosphate-buffered solution, pH 7.2, containing 0.09% sodium azide and BSA (origin USA).
Preparation
The antibody was purified by affinity chromatography and conjugated with Brilliant Violet 421? under optimal conditions.
Concentration
Lot-specific (to obtain lot-specific concentration, please enter the lot number in our Concentration and Expiration Lookup or Certificate of Analysis online tools.)
Storage & Handling
The antibody solution should be stored undiluted between 2°C and 8°C, and protected from prolonged exposure to light. Do not freeze.
Application

FC - Quality tested

Recommended Usage

Each lot of this antibody is quality control tested by immunofluorescent staining with flow cytometric analysis. For flow cytometric staining, the suggested use of this reagent is 5 ?l per million cells in 100 ?l staining volume or 5 ?l per 100 ?l of whole blood.

Brilliant Violet 421? excites at 405 nm and emits at 421 nm. The standard bandpass filter 450/50 nm is recommended for detection. Brilliant Violet 421? is a trademark of Sirigen Group Ltd.

Application Notes

Additional reported applications (for the relevant formats) include: immunohistochemical staining of acetone-fixed frozen sections4, immunofluorescence microscopy6, Western blotting10, and in vitro blocking of LPS-induced cytokine production2,3,7,9. This clone was tested in-house and does not work on formalin fixed paraffin-embedded (FFPE) tissue. For most successful immunofluorescent staining results, it may be important to maximize signal over background by using a relatively bright fluorochrome-antibody conjugate (Cat. No. 312806) or by using a high sensitivity, three-layer staining technique (e.g., including a biotinylated antibody (Cat. No. 312804) or biotinylated anti-mouse IgG second step (Cat. No. 405303), followed by SAv-PE (Cat. No. 405204). The Ultra-LEAF? purified antibody (Endotoxin < 0.01 EU/?g, Azide-Free, 0.2 ?m filtered) is recommended for functional assays (Cat. No. 312813 & 312814).?

Antigen Details

Structure
Type I transmembrane protein, Toll-like receptor family/IL-1R superfamily, 110 kD
Distribution

Monocytes/macrophages, endothelial cells, B cells and granulocytes

Function
Activates the innate immune system against Gram-negative bacterial pathogens by recognition of LPS
Ligand/Receptor
Bacterial LPS
Cell Type
B cells, Endothelial cells, Granulocytes, Macrophages, Monocytes, Tregs
Biology Area
Cell Biology, Immunology, Innate Immunity, Neuroinflammation, Neuroscience, Neuroscience Cell Markers
Molecular Family
CD Molecules, Toll Like Receptors
